Six
House of the Ages
King Ondor watched the remnants of the sun slip from the horizon, cast an adoring look out over the city and turned from the balcony back to his chambers.
âHoom.â His golden eyebrows tightened.
The brackets were extinguished, dousing the chamber in darkness. At the other side, amethyst light filtered through drawn silk drapes. He reached into his robes and drew a knife.
The hunter was stood at the opposite window, arms folded, looking out on the city. The muzzle of his wolfâs cloak nuzzled up against the nape of his neck, its hind claws scraping the ground. He made a dark silhouette against the fading straits of light.
Knife still drawn, Ondor stepped into the middle of the room. âTo whom do I owe the pleasure?â
The hunter spoke without turning. âYou didnât tell him.â
âI told him what he needed to know for the next part of his journey.â
âYes, you did that.â The hunter fingered the fabric of the drapes. He turned to face Ondor, beard and fierce eyes momentarily lit by the amethyst light before eclipsing back into darkness. âBut you didnât tell him everything. You said once you believed my predictions about whatâs coming, so why waste his time?â
âI know few men who can converse with nature, strike fear into the hearts of TâChoruck captains and even command kings. Only you.â Ondor sheathed his knife. âVery well, Tempest, I shall tell him.â
The hunter, Tempest, nodded and turned to leave. Ondor stepped closer, his hazel-gold eyes straying into columns of waning light.
âWhere will you go?â
âOh Iâll be around. When you need me, just call.â
